TS I recommend a survey and a market study. Never underestimate/overestimate the potential business.
Before everything, I really suggest you do the market study. Its not worth much but pays a lot.
Also, don't ask Yes/No questions. People tend to say Yes all the time. Ask questions that engage people like:
*Where do you go when you need to use the computer?
*How much do you pay when you do?
*How often do you need to use a computer?
